An Introduction To The Completely Different Dog Collars And Their Functions

Thursday, February 10th, 2011

There are many different types of dog collars obtainable for all dogs of all sizes. Not every collar is suitable for each operate and activities. Canine owners should take the duty to look at the differing types before choosing and shopping for a collar for their dog.

Beneath is a list of widespread canine collars and their perform:

1. Traditional Collars – Traditional collars are the most well-liked and could be made from many alternative materials and in many different styles. They match across the animal’s neck and may have a loop to attach a leash and add identification tags and medical tags.

2. Harnesses – Many small dog homeowners prefer utilizing a pet harness because it does not tug on the dog’s neck. A harness is mostly a more sensible choice for more energetic animals as a result of they can’t wriggle out of it as they’ll with a standard collar. Harnesses are also used on sled canines to drag sleds and often used by homeowners who jog or curler blade with their dog.

3. Choke/Slip Collars – A choke collar is used each to remind your canine you need his attention and to appropriate the dog. Your dog should only wear the collar during training sessions. Use the collar only while you plan to enforce commands.

4. Self-Adjusted Collars – These slipknot type collars are handy because they’ve the leash already connected and could be adjusted to totally different pets’ sizes. If the canine tends to pull on the leash, nevertheless, a self-adjusted collar just isn’t as favorable as a result of it may simply change into too tight.

5. Prong Collars – These collars are used completely for coaching, and have blunt metallic prongs connected to the within edge to discourage a canine from resisting a trainer’s commands or pulling on the leash. Prong collars can be hazardous, and will never be left on an unattended animal or used for disciplinary purposes.

6. Electric Collars – These specialised collars are fashionable with trainers, particularly for searching dogs. They use small electric shocks to appropriate misbehavior however ought to by no means be utilized by inexperienced homeowners or for casual household training.

7. Head Collars & Halti Collars – These distinctive collars endure from their unfortunate appearance: because they connect across the animal’s muzzle and the again of the top, they’re usually mistaken for protecting muzzles.

In reality, they function on the simple philosophy of main the animal by the pinnacle quite than the neck. A dog’s pure intuition is to resist being pulled by the neck, which is why many canines struggle leashes and conventional collars. Head collars work on totally different ideas and are extra snug for both the animal and the proprietor, regardless of a startling resemblance to muzzles.

The collars listed above are among the common collars out there in the market. Do word that some of the dog collars would require some knowledge to use them accurately, for example the electrical, prong and head collars. Be sure you understand the basic idea earlier than you start utilizing them.

Where To Buy Goat Meat And What To Look Out For?

Tuesday, February 8th, 2011

Ever thought what could be the reason for goat meats to become more and more popular? What is in them that a lot of people are opting to buy them instead of chicken, pork, or other meat products? Goat meat consumption has actually been around for centuries. It is considered the traditional meat in many regions in the Middle East, Africa, the Caribbean, and even across South East Asia. So do you know where to buy meat goats?

Knowing where to buy goat meat is quite important especially when goat meat production is not as popular yet in the United States compared to other parts of world, particularly Australia and New Zealand. These two countries are considered to be the largest producers of goat meat products around the world.

When buying meat from goat, it is important to know the different types of goat breeds since the quality of the meat depends on which type of goat you get. So before telling you where to buy goat meat of good quality, it is important that you are aware of the different types of meat goat breeds.

The Spanish variety is regarded develop good quality of meat. It is also known to contain less fat. Livestock breeders are now learning to cross the Spanish variety with Boer in the desire of producing bigger and a better meat quality. However, most cross-bred goats are considered to be more suitable in milk production and their meat is not as excellent compared to the pure breeds. Cross breeds cost less than pure breeds and they are easily available in the market.

Another type of goat is the Angora variety. Angora meat is also well known for its excellent quality; nevertheless it is not readily obtainable since this variety is not capable of adapting to cold weather.

The Boer variety is a little costly to raise that is the reason why the meat from Boer goat is more steep. The expensive price more than even out the good meat quality it produces.

It is also good to point out that meat from goat is sold as capretto or chevon. Capretto is in Italian language for kid goat, hence, capretto relates to the meat of a kid goat. This type of meat is lean and colored pink.

Chevon refers to goats that are bigger and heavier and are aged between 6 to 18 months. This type is more flavorful and is firm.

Be Taught About Pug Dogs And Why They Make Great Family Pets

Sunday, February 6th, 2011

The Pug is a compact dog that’s often described as “a variety of dog in a small space.” Nonetheless, regardless of his attribute brief and stocky body, the most distinctive function of a Pug is his head. His massive, darkish orb-like eyes, flat nose and wrinkly face are the principle features that distinguish Pugs from their different dog cousins.

Pugs are definitely one of many oldest canine breeds identified today. It’s believed this Toy breed originated in Asia sometime before four hundred BC. Throughout their historical past Pugs have been adored by many noble people from all different royal houses of the world. That being stated, they really established himself in Holland throughout the 16th century when he saved William (the prince) of Orange’s life by alerting him to the strategy of Spaniards. This earned the Pug honorary recognition and he grew to become the official canine of the House of Orange.

As you’ll be able to see from their historical past, Pugs make a wonderful watchdog. They don’t yap unnecessarily, however will bring the method of strangers to the eye of their family. Though they’ll alert house owners to strangers, they aren’t an aggressive dog. The Pug could be very affectionate and loving and is friendly in direction of all. He enjoys the corporate of children and visitors and is happiest when he has the attention of these he loves. This breed will show jealous behaviors if ignored.

Pugs are fairly clever and are simply trained, however they have a short attention span and will tire with repetitive lessons. Owners should also remember the fact that these canines are delicate and do best with light but firm teaching.

The Pug stands 12-14 inches and can weigh up to 20 pounds. His weight can simply exceed this amount if train and normal activity shouldn’t be encouraged. Pugs are lazy and will lie around if given the chance. Their inactivity makes them good city canines and they are glad in apartments.

Regardless of this reality, apart from turning into chubby, different well being problems Pugs undergo from embrace skin points (IE. dry pores and skin) extreme sensitivity to cold and hot temperatures, allergies, and power breathing problems because of their flat muzzle. Regardless of their health issues, they dwell a mean of 12 – 15 years. As was talked about, they are vulnerable to respiration issues and may, subsequently, be supplied with enough train with out overdoing it. In other phrases, take the Pug on a number of brief walks a day (climate allowing) and engage him in energetic games.

The Pug is out there in numerous coat colours including fawn, apricot, silver and black. Whatever the colour, their muzzle is all the time black. Their clean quick coat is simple to groom and solely requires a brushing a couple of occasions per week. That being said, the Pug does need the wrinkles on his face cleaned repeatedly to keep away from skin problems from occurring. You should also know that Pugs are heavy shedders during shedding season, and they usually grunt and snore when they sleep.

Any devoted Pug proprietor will let you know that this pooch is a charmer that will win the heart of any canine lover.

Electric Collar – What To Look For

Thursday, February 3rd, 2011

It’s always more prudent to research before you make the purchase, especially when you’re planning to get electric collar for your pet. Here are some of those features.

Just the right transmission range. Decide on this first, because it affects everything. Maybe you just need a training collar for your backyard, when you bring your dog out there. If you have working dogs or sheep dogs, you may need a considerably longer range. Remember that some models carry heftier prices because of their capacity to work in great distances and on multiple dogs, so the choice is really up to you.

Feature that tells how much power the batteries on the transmitter and collar remains, and how far your dog is from the transmitter. It’s handy to have a feature that tells you how far your dog is from you, when you’re holding the transmitter; that way you can call your dog back when it tries to leave transmission range. If you’re out on the park or are using the remote training collars in a large area (such as a farm on some hunting ground) this features might come handy. The battery indicator feature shouldn’t underestimated, either 9if the batteries run out unexpectedly, you want to know before that happens). This is so that you can see immediately when you need to cancel your hunting, or any activity, owing to the possibility your dogs could run off while the collar’s batteries are dead or dangerously low.

Audible signals. It’s always reassuring to hear a sound after you pressed or clicked on something, as a way of knowing that something happened. That way when your dog’s collar is within earshot, you can also hear the beep on the collar, so you can immediately tell if your dog is nearby.

Batteries you can keep recharging over and over. Some electric collar models come with detachable batteries – the standard kind that needs to be replaced with new ones. Since not every dog owner keeps bringing with him or her new sets of batteries, it’s better to go with a model with batteries you can recharge both in your home and in your own car.

Clear transmission all the time. You may want to get models that rely on FM signals for very clear transmission. That means your transmitter can reliably send signals to the collar even when you find yourself in hilly, wooded, and urban areas with so many buildings.

Multiple dog capability. You might want an electric collar package that already has many collars – and one transmitter – or at least the capacity to buy more collars later on, in case the number of your dogs increase.

Controls you don’t need a degree to figure out. In the age of the iPhone when user interface and ease of use can make or break a product, you want a transmitter for your electric collar that won’t give you a headache just to figure it out. So shop one that you think, after reading up on reviews about some models, offers an intuitive user experience.

Getting Rid Of Your Dog’s Separation Anxiety

Wednesday, February 2nd, 2011

When you get ready to leave your home, does your dog act very strangely? Does he or she bark, whine and scratch to try to get to you? That is most likely a symptom of separation anxiousness and millions of canines experience it. Your canine will experience concern, insecurity and nervousness when you are leaving and when you are gone. They might additionally resort to self mutilating, destructive habits, attempting to escape to be able to find you and more.

There’s good news for pet house owners who’re coping with separation anxiety. You possibly can really assist your canine relieve a few of the stress and anxiety by training him or her to take care of their feelings. Though medication is needed for some animals, you need to attempt habits modification first. This situation is an actual medical situation that will worsen with time. It will not merely get higher on its own. Take your canine to see the veterinarian with the intention to have an exam carried out to be sure that nothing else is unsuitable together with your dog. He or she may have some beneficial advice as well.

You do not wish to make the issue worse, either. When you spoil your canine and give him undivided attention, he will probably be a lot worse off whenever you leave. You might want to teach the canine that she or he can self soothe and will probably be simply fantastic with out you. So, reward your canine when she or he performs by themselves. You must give your dog consideration only while you’re prepared to offer her or him attention. Don’t respond when your canine demands attention. In the event that they climb on you, simply push them off without wanting of their eyes. Then, when you are ready to provide your canine consideration, call her or him over and give your canine some attention. You also needs to ignore your canine when she or he barks or cries for you. You need to show that you are the chief!

Train is vital for a healthy, pleased and effectively-adjusted dog. Try about 15 minutes of good exercise each day and earlier than you leave. You want to enable your dog time to tire himself or herself out. Being exhausted will keep your dog calmer. You additionally wish to get your canine accustomed to you leaving, in order that he or she is not going to really feel as stressed. Give your canine attention for about 20 minutes before you leave. This may assist him deal with your absence.

You can strive giving your canine entry to only one part of your home and as the behavior changes, you may give her or him a bigger part of the house. A baby gate will do the trick for most dogs. Try to depart him with some treats and toys while you go away and this can assist him stay occupied. Bones, squeak toys, etc. Something like that ought to work. Record your self speaking and he can listen to it whilst you’re gone. Play it whilst you’re there in order that he or she becomes acquainted with it. Decide up the things that your dog can get into and make sure that nothing’s inside paw reach. Spray different objects with a bitter so that your canine will immediately go away them alone.

Separation nervousness is troublesome to deal with, but through habits modification, you need to be capable of eliminate the unfavourable habits and calm the fears inside your dog that’s inflicting them. The hot button is to have endurance and imagine in your dog!
